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ary commands on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to authorization bypass. A remote unauthenticated attacker can execute arbitrary commands on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
Mitigation
Cybersecurity Help is currently unaware of any official solution to address this vulnerability.
Vulnerable software versions
User Post Gallery – UPG: 1.40 - 2.19
